Twisted shapes and strong texture were chosen to represent a magnificent old and gnarled tree, like many that can be found in most coastal places. The following poem by the artist, Susan Lackey, was inspired by this artwork.
There is a gnarled old tree, down by the sea,
So strong and true, is how it grew.
No storm nor gale will bend this friend.
A limb may break, but it will mend.
12 inches x 12 inches
mixed media
Painting panel with .75 inch sides
The Remnants Collection
These paintings either the first ones or last ones of a variety of collections. Art Exhibitions tend to contain artwork from a single collection. When there are only a few paintings remaining in a collection, it’s difficult to show them with others. Sometimes a collection is started and after just a few paintings, the artist stops the series for various reasons. These also become difficult to show with others. Because these are some of the artist’s favorites, they are presented here in a patchwork collection of remnants.
